Tocantins

The Tocantins is a major river of central and northern Brazil, running about 2,450 kilometers north through the states of Goiás, Tocantins, and Pará. It forms the principal channel of the Tocantins-Araguaia basin and reaches the Pará River near the Marajó Bay system. Columbia

The Columbia River is the largest river in the Pacific Northwest, rising in British Columbia and flowing about 2,000 kilometers through Washington and along the Washington-Oregon border to the Pacific Ocean.
